Grade List for Tungsten Carbide Shear Blade:
Grade |
Performance |
Performance&application recommended |
||
Density |
Bend Strength |
Hardness |
||
G/Cm3 |
N/mm2 |
HRA |
||
YG6A |
14.95 |
1800 |
92.5 |
Fine grain alloy, good wear resistance,Semi-finishin of chilled |
cast iron, non-ferrous metals alloys, semi-finishing and finishing |
||||
of hardened steel,alloy steel. |
||||
YG8 |
14.8 |
2200 |
89.5 |
High strength in use,impact and shock resistnace higher than |
YG6,but wear resistance and cutting speed comparatively lower |
||||
Roughing of cast irons, non-ferrous metalsand their alloys as |
||||
well as non metallic materials at low cutting speed. |
||||
YG10X |
14.5 |
2400 |
91.5 |
Fine grain alloy, good wear resistance,Used for processing hard |
wood, veneer board,PCB,PVC and metals. |
||||
YL10.2 |
14.5 |
2400 |
91.8 |
Fine grade alloy,with high wear resistance,high bending strength |
high resistance to bonding ,high termal strength,Machining of |
||||
refractory alloys,stainless steel and high manganese steel,etc. |
||||
YG20 |
14.3 |
2420 |
90 |
Conventional wear resistance, high bending strength,used for |
steel alloy ect. |
